A core-making center is a comprehensive system that integrates a core-making machine, robot, and other equipment to automate core-making, coring, coating, drying, and transportation processes. A small core-making center is designed to perform the functions of automatic core-making, core-taking, and conveying to the designated position. This may include the production of simple cores such as brake discs. A large core-making center may be composed of several smaller core-making centers. It is responsible for core assembly work, including painting, drying, and automatically assembling different cores together. This requires the cooperation of a large number of robots.
